Characteristics of a Superficial Structure

A superficial structure typically exhibits the following traits:

  • Visible Form Without Internal Detail – The outward shape or pattern is evident, but the internal architecture is either minimal or absent.
  • Limited Functional Depth – Operations rely on surface‑level interactions rather than dependable, multi‑layered processes.
  • Ease of Replication – Because the design is straightforward, it can be copied quickly, often leading to mass production of shallow imitations.
  • Temporary or Context‑Dependent – Such structures may be useful in specific scenarios but tend to degrade when faced with more demanding conditions.

To give you an idea, a painted cardboard cutout of a tree is superficial: it shows the outline and color of a tree but contains no roots, sap, or cellular life.

Everyday Examples

1. Superficial Social Media Posts

  • A tweet that merely states a popular opinion without supporting evidence.
  • Why it matters: Readers may be persuaded by the surface message while missing the nuanced arguments behind it.

2. Shallow Architectural Decorations

  • Facades that mimic classical columns using lightweight materials.
  • Why it matters: The building looks grand, yet the structural load‑bearing system may rely on modern engineering rather than the historic stone construction the style suggests.

3. Surface‑Level Learning Techniques

  • Memorizing vocabulary lists without understanding grammatical rules.
  • Why it matters: Learners can recall words but struggle to use them correctly in context.

Frequently Asked Questions

Q1: Can something be both superficial and deep? A: Yes. An object may present a simple exterior while housing nuanced internal mechanisms. The key is to evaluate both the visible and hidden aspects.

Q2: Why do designers intentionally create superficial elements?
A: Superficial design can attract attention, convey brand identity, or meet regulatory standards quickly. It serves as a first impression that can be refined later.

Q3: How can I avoid being misled by superficial information?
A: Ask probing questions, seek underlying data, and test the structure under varied conditions to reveal hidden complexities The details matter here..

Q4: Is “superficial” always a negative judgment?

Q5: How do professionals decide when superficial design is enough?
A: They consider the purpose, audience, and risk. A decorative pattern on a poster may not need structural depth, but a medical device, bridge, software system, or educational curriculum does. If failure would have serious consequences, superficial design is rarely sufficient.

Q6: Can a superficial layer become meaningful over time?
A: Yes. What begins as a surface-level feature can acquire symbolic, cultural, or emotional significance. Fashion trends, slogans, visual motifs, and architectural details often start as simple outward choices but later become associated with identity, memory, or social movements But it adds up..

Q7: What is the best way to describe something as superficial without sounding dismissive?
A: Use precise language. Instead of saying something is “just superficial,” say that it is “surface-oriented,” “primarily aesthetic,” “limited to visible features,” or “not yet supported by deeper structure.” This keeps the observation analytical rather than judgmental.
